Abstract
The utility model discloses a kind of power equipment high-temperature alarming device, including the controller for being mounted on the temperature sensor of four edges of inner top of electric power cabinet cabinet body and being mounted on the inner sidewall of electric power cabinet cabinet door, touch display screen is installed on the front side wall of electric power cabinet cabinet door, controller includes microprocessor, power module and network communication module, microprocessor and network communication module are electrically connected with power module, network communication module is electrically connected with microprocessor, touch display screen is electrically connected with microprocessor, and four temperature sensors are electrically connected with microprocessor;Warning message only when all temperature sensors detect that the temperature in electric power cabinet cabinet body is higher than temperature upper limit, can be just sent to monitor supervision platform, so, can be effectively reduced the probability of false alarm by the utility model;And by the settings of four temperature sensors, it is capable of increasing the detection range to the temperature in electric power cabinet cabinet body, the phenomenon that so as to avoid the occurrence of missing inspection.

Background technique
In the power equipment course of work, power equipment can generate more heat, as the temperature in power equipment is excessively high
When, it will lead to power equipment and the phenomenon that burning or damaging occur, to will cause unnecessary loss;In order to realize to electricity
The detection of temperature in power equipment is generally fitted with temperature sensor in current power equipment, but current electric power is set
A temperature sensor is only generally installed in standby, which can only realize the detection to a certain range of temperature,
So, the phenomenon that being easy to appear missing inspection or false alarm.

The power equipment high-temperature alarming device of the utility model, four sides of inner top including being mounted on electric power cabinet cabinet body 1
Temperature sensor 2 at angle and the controller 4 being mounted on the inner sidewall of electric power cabinet cabinet door 3, the front side wall of electric power cabinet cabinet door 3
On touch display screen 5 is installed, controller 4 includes microprocessor 41, power module 42 and network communication module 43, microprocessor
41 and network communication module 43 be electrically connected with power module 42, network communication module 43 is electrically connected with microprocessor 41, touch
Display screen 5 is electrically connected with microprocessor 41, and four temperature sensors 2 are electrically connected with microprocessor 41;Practical new using this
When type, temperature upper limit is set in the microprocessor in controller by touch display screen first, then by network communication
Module and monitor supervision platform establish communication connection;When the utility model at work, four temperature sensors being capable of real-time detection electric power
Temperature in cabinet cabinet body only detects electric power cabinet cabinet in all temperature sensors when the temperature in electric power cabinet cabinet body increases
When temperature in body is higher than temperature upper limit, warning message can be just sent to monitor supervision platform so be can be effectively reduced
The probability of false alarm;And pass through the setting of four temperature sensors, it is capable of increasing the detection model to the temperature in electric power cabinet cabinet body
It encloses, the phenomenon that so as to avoid the occurrence of missing inspection;Temperature sensor, touch display screen, power module, net in the utility model
Network communication module and microprocessor are existing apparatus and module at present on the market, such as single-chip microcontroller system can be used in microprocessor
System or PLC controller, the utility model are the combined application realized to existing module, therefore not to temperature sensor, touch
Display screen, power module, network communication module and microprocessor principle repeated.
Each temperature sensor 2 is fixed on the inner top of electric power cabinet cabinet body 1 by a bracket 6, and each bracket 6 wraps
First horizontal segment 61, the second horizontal segment 62 and the vertical section 63 for connecting first horizontal segment 61 and the second horizontal segment 62 are included, temperature
Degree sensor 2 is fixed in first horizontal segment 61, and first horizontal segment 61 is integrally formed towards one end of 1 inner sidewall of electric power cabinet cabinet body
There are two the inserted link 611 in front-rear direction distribution, it is provided with respectively on the inner sidewall of electric power cabinet cabinet body 1 for a wherein root cutting bar
The jacks 11 of 611 insertions, activity is equipped with bolt 7 in the second horizontal segment 62, and the second horizontal segment 62 passes through bolt 7 and electric power cabinet cabinet
The inner top of body 1 is fixed;After by using this structure, temperature sensor can be securely fixed in the interior top of electric power cabinet cabinet body
In portion, and have the advantages that temperature sensor is fixed conveniently.
It is provided with to cooperate with the outer wall of inserted link 611 on the inner wall of 11 open end of jack and be oriented to facilitate inserted link 611 to be inserted into
Annular guide surface 12 into jack 11;By the setting of annular guide surface, inserted link can cooperate guiding with side with annular guide surface
Just inserted link is inserted into jack.
Inserted link 611 is provided on the outer wall far from 61 one end of first horizontal segment to cooperate guiding with side with the inner wall of jack 11
Just inserted link 611 is inserted into the annular slope 612 in jack 11;By the setting of annular slope, annular slope can in jack
Wall cooperation guiding is to facilitate inserted link to be inserted into jack.
Network communication module 43 is cable network communication module or wireless network communication module;The cable network communication module
RJ45 ether net type wired network road communication module can be used, which can be used Wifi network communication module.
